### Escalation — Export Memory Pressure

If a Tallygrid spreadsheet export exceeds 4 GB resident memory, the watchdog kills the worker and logs a heap summary. Before escalating, confirm the summary shows the row-buffer allocator as the dominant consumer, and note the tenant and sheet dimensions. Include both in the escalation ticket. Once those details are gathered, send the full report to the team at the address below.

pager mailbox: silael.sorwyn.tamius@zemvarsys.corp

**TICKET: Partner SFTP drop — creds expired**

Priority: High. The Braxon Foods nightly SFTP drop stopped Tuesday; their upload cert rotated and our side expired too. Contractor task: regenerate the drop credentials via Vaultline, update the transfer job in Ferryman, and confirm the next scheduled pull succeeds. Do not touch the archive bucket config. Ferryman's admin endpoint is internal-only; you'll need to authenticate before the credential swap will take. The key for the Ferryman admin API is below.

API key for fahip-kahip: zpat23_XiJGUHz5xfaAtaIqUkus0rh

Onboarding note for the Ledgerpane admin table: bulk edits are applied through the batcher service, not directly against the database. Select rows, choose an action, and the batcher stages changes in a pending set you can review before commit. Edits over 500 rows require a second approver — this is enforced server-side, so don't try to chunk around it. To run the batcher locally you need the staging write credential, which goes in your .env as the next line.

secret setting of bahip-kagag: RELAY_SECRET3=c83